What to Do After an Accident
After you’re in an accident, the first thing to do is get medical attention for yourself and anyone else involved. This is crucial, both to make sure you’re OK and to back up your case later. Next, gather all the evidence you can at the scene. Take photos if you’re able to do so safely. Make notes and draw diagrams. If you were in a car accident, report the accident to your insurance company when you get home. Be brief and stick to the facts.
